John Gill's Exposition on Esther 8:13

The copy of the writing, for a commandment to be given in every province, was published to all people, etc.] A copy of the letters sent to the governors of provinces; the sum and substance of them was published by an herald, or fixed in public places, that all might know the contents thereof; and take care not to assault the Jews, as it would be to their peril: and that the Jews should be ready against that day to avenge themselves on their enemies; Abendana thinks this is to be restrained to those that were of the seed of Amalek, who were their principal enemies; but no doubt it includes all that should rise up against them.
